Lindsay Hs is a State/Public serving high age pupils, located in Lindsay, Garvin County. The school has 324 pupils enrolled. It is part of the Lindsay school district. It serves grades 9โ12 in a rural setting. The school employs 20.1 full-time-equivalent teachers, a student-teacher ratio of 16.1:1. 22% of students are proficient in reading. 12% are proficient in maths. The four-year graduation rate is 97%. The school offers dual enrollment, a gifted and talented program. Technology infrastructure includes fiber internet, campus-wide Wi-Fi, devices for students.
Lindsay Hs enrolls 324 students across grades 9โ12. The student body is 51% male and 49% female. A teaching staff of 20.1 full-time-equivalent teachers supports the school, giving a student-teacher ratio of 16.1:1.
By race and ethnicity, the student body is 68% White, 14% Hispanic or Latino and 14% American Indian or Alaska Native.

145 of the school's 324 students (45%) q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. The school participates in the National School Lunch Program. Free and reduced-price lunch eligibility is a widely used indicator of the share of students from lower-income households.
Lindsay Hs is located in a rural setting (NCES locale: Rural, Distant). The school runs a schoolwide Title I program, which provides federal funding to support students from low-income families. For civic and policy purposes, the school sits in congressional district OK-40, state senate district 43, state house district 42.
Lindsay Hs is one of 3 schools in LINDSAY, based in Lindsay, Oklahoma. The district serves 1,130 students district-wide and employs 75 full-time-equivalent teachers. With 324 students, Lindsay Hs is close to the district average of about 377 students per school.
